Yes, I am adding my first fertilizer (1/4th strength) on Thursday for the KC's and Saturday for the SD's and Cluster. Will take pics after adding it. You should add fert at around 2-3 weeks after germination. I will be using Alaska Fish Fert with is relatively cheap and effective.
